What Is a Base Plate?
A Base Plate is a load-bearing, datum-establishing structural component used to:
- Provide a primary reference plane for fixtures or assemblies
- Transfer loads to underlying structural members
- Anchor modular assemblies to frames or foundations
- Maintain geometric stability during operation
At the system level, it defines the foundational geometry upon which subsystems are constructed.
Specifications
Standard Sizes
- 300 mm × 300 mm (12″ × 12″)
- 600 mm × 600 mm (24″ × 24″)
- 900 mm × 900 mm (36″ × 36″)

Materials
- 6061-T6 Aluminum (standard)
- 7075-T6 Aluminum (optional)
- Steel or stainless steel (on request)
Finishes
- As-machined
- Clear anodize
- Black anodize
- Custom finishes upon request
Tolerances
- Flatness / parallelism: ±0.001″
- Hole position: ±0.002″
- Tighter tolerances available upon request
